There are a lot of places to get coffee in Bowling Green, Ohio. So, I believe the independent shops must bring something to the competition, or they wouldn't be around anymore. This establishment is in the downtown strip, there is street parking and parking behind the buildings (though, I do not know if there is a public back entrance). I stopped by around 9 or 10 on a Saturday morning and there were tons of people in line. (This is Summer, when college is not in session). I opted to go for breakfast elsewhere and try back later. I stopped by again around 3pm and there was no waiting. The service area appeared clean and orderly, & the staff was helpful. They offer a wide range of coffee and espresso based beverages. They offer a selection of pastries and a few different cheesecakes by the slice. The seating area has the feel of a new & used bookstore or a library. The house coffee was ok. 3pm on a hot and humid day might not be the best day to judge quality of hot coffee. I'll probably check them out again later this week.

Read moreA legacy well-earned in a university town, Grounds is the rare & friendly time capsule of a cafe with all of the best elements one imagines for that type of establishment... It is quite sincerely unique in that it will conjure up those elements that are equally magical & authentic for the past & present denizens of Bowling Green University, whether a new arrival on campus or an alumnus from 30 years ago.
Part book shop, part vinyl record store, with healthy vibrant doses of political & cultural activity, topped off as an easygoing meeting place and performance venue. And always the welcoming, inspiring, glowing cafe with exceptional coffee & tea variations, and a comforting spectrum of baked victuals, Grounds For Thought would have taken hold and been just as inspirational in 19th century Vienna as it remains here today in NW Ohio.
